ELECTION AFTERMATH
APPEAL AGAINST" RETHRN. OF PADDINGTON CANDIDATE. (Received 9 a.m.). SYDNEY, This Day. The struggle to secure entry into Parliament apparently is hot at an end with the elections, as a not her >ean didate who was defeated at the ..polls has appealed to the Elections Qualifications Committee against the election of his opponent. .. . L In this ease Mr W. ,E. R-, Bates, Labour candidate for the Pa&dihgton electorate, has appealed - , against the election of Mr D. Levy*; exHSphaker, on the grounds that many irregularities occurred with regard; tp postal votes.—A. and N.Z. -v , -
